The official status of Omega’s Speedmaster Professional as that of “Moonwatch” is widely known and celebrated amongst enthusiasts and certainly by Omega themselves. Unlike many brand partnerships, the relationship between Omega and NASA has yielded real, tangible benefits, with the Speedmaster itself making appearances in each of the manned missions to the Moon, and even contributing to one of the greatest dramas of the 20th century, helping the astronauts of Apollo 13 return safely to Earth after an oxygen tank explosion two days into the mission. To gain a more personal perspective on this relationship, Omega sent us to NASA headquarters in Houston, where we had access to astronauts Jim Lovell (Gemini 7, 12; Apollo 8, 13) and Tom Stafford (Gemini 6A, 9A; Apollo 10; ASTP). This very week the anniversary of the Edict of Nantes is coming round for the 411th time.It was on April 13, 1598 or on April 30, 1598 (sources differ on the exact date) that the king of France, Henri IV signed the edict.With his signature the king pronounced the end of the religious wars which had ravaged the country. The protestants were re-instated as subjects of the crown and awarded the same civic rights the catholic subjects had enjoyed un-interruptedly. Most clock makers were protestants and had fled France to Switzerland, Germany, Great Britain and the Netherlands some years earlier. A great many of them decided to go home to their native country again. It is how France became the number one time keeping device country again.It was the revocation of the Edict of Nantes by one of Henry IV's successor, the famous Louis XIV in 1685 which lead to a new exodus of the protestant clock makers to Switzerland.
